Medco sells US asset for $45.5 million

Tuesday, February 22 2005 - 01:10 AM WIB

Cayman Islands-based oil and gas firm Lodore Resources Inc said Tuesday that Medco Energi had sold its 30 percent working interest in the Stratton field onshore South Texas to Apache Corporation, the operator of the oil field, for US$45.5 million.

Lodore is contractually entitled to receive 35 percent of the consideration, net of any costs, received by Medco above a pre-determined benchmark price which is US$120 million for the entire portfolio in the United States acquired from Australia?s Novus Petroleum last year.

However, Apache's purchase of the 30 percent working interest in the Stratton field was made under a preferential purchase right and as such the sale was not part of the auction process that was initiated by Medco for the remainder of the US assets, Lodore said in a statement to London Stock Exchange.

Lodore added that it had formally commenced negotiations to acquire the remainder of the US assets, comprising the producing properties in Louisiana as well as the high impact exploration acreage on Padre Island. (Robert)
